About me

I am so very glad to see you have thought about receiving help to be the best you can be! We all have room for improvement, and you recognize having positive support can help. I am dedicated to help others navigate obstacles, develop holistically, and accomplish goals. My counseling style is compassionate and interactive.

My training, experience, and life has prepared me to work with a wide range of concerns. I am very much person- centered serving with respect and sensitivity, utilizing varied therapeutic approaches. Working with teens require recognizing this very critical time in their life, undertanding insight on brain development during this growth period. I have extensive experience with this population, individually, family sessions, group sessions, as well as counseling at an Adolescent Group Home. I have worked successfully with addictions, ADHD, anxiety, depression, and other diagnosis with teens. Manuvering familly life with parents and/or siblings, school and personal trials can become very demanding and overwhelming. I am here to help determine personal effective tools to build relationships, increase self esteem and overcome personal diagnosis.

I believe it is important for me to work with you in developing a personal treatment plan necessary for your needs. You are capable of accomplishing goals and living a fulfilling, meaningful life. I am ready to assist in accomplishing just that!
